I tried now several things without success and wanted to know if someone else found a workaround:

Case: Draw Text at the position of the Album Art if no album art is found...

Problem: I get only scrolling lines drawn (if they actually scroll... the pure %s definition is not sufficient)

Why: Very small Screen... Would like to enjoy album art very big if possible otherwise draw text with different fonts = different viewports. As far as i know theres not yet any possibility to define viewports in conditionals which would solve this entirely
